When considering adjustable dumbbells, think about the weight range you need. Most models cater to various strength levels. It’s essential to find a set that fits your fitness journey. Also, check if the locking mechanism is secure. Poor quality mechanisms can lead to accidents and injuries.
Tips: Always warm up before your workouts. Spend extra time focusing on your form. A good posture prevents injuries and maximizes results. Start with lighter weights to get used to movements. Gradually increase the weight as you feel comfortable. Don't rush the process; reflect on your progress regularly.

The electronic adjustable dumbbell market is rapidly evolving. These tools provide seamless weight adjustments, ideal for home workouts. Price points vary widely, with mid-range models costing between $300 to $600 per pair. However, premium versions exceed $800, making them a significant investment. According to market research, over 60% of users cite convenience as their primary reason for purchase.
When considering value, durability and functionality are crucial. Many fitness enthusiasts seek products lasting several years. Some models offer features like app connectivity, enhancing user experience, but often at a higher cost. A common concern is that not all expensive options provide equal performance. Therefore, research is key.
**Tip:** Always check for warranties. A solid warranty can indicate manufacturer confidence.
Another aspect to consider is the resale value. Some adjustable dumbbells depreciate quickly. Hence, buying new might not always be the best option. Exploring secondhand markets may yield some bargains.
**Tip:** Look for local fitness groups. They often sell gently used equipment, sometimes including adjustable dumbbells.
In 2026, electronic adjustable dumbbells have surged in popularity among home fitness enthusiasts. User reviews reveal a complex landscape of satisfaction and performance ratings. A recent industry report notes that 72% of users appreciate the convenience of adjusting weights quickly. This flexibility is crucial for maintaining workout intensity and motivation.
However, not every user is content. Some report issues with durability, especially with the weight adjustment mechanism. About 18% of reviews highlight malfunctions after only a few months of use. For many, reliability is as vital as functionality. Users want their equipment to last through intense routines without failure.
The overall sentiment indicates a need for improvement in certain models. Many reviews suggest that designs can inadvertently lead to user errors. At times, buttons are not as responsive as expected. This can disrupt workout flow. Consequently, while most enjoy the benefits of electronic dumbbells, there is a clear call for enhancements. Users want seamless operability paired with lasting quality.
